What is Crypto

Crypto is short for cryptography. Recently, the scope of its meaning has expanded to include a broader range of definitions. These meanings can include basic cryptographic concepts or an entire ecosystem of crypto-enabled technologies, enterprises, and communities.

Cryptography is a multidisciplinary field that is focused on securing and validating information. It borrows and applies concepts from mathematics, computer science, electrical engineering, and physics.

What are NFTs

The acronym NFTs refers to Non-Fungible-Tokens. NFTs represent unique assets with properties that are not replaceable. These tokens contrast with Fungible Tokens that can be easily interchanged with another equal or similar asset (e.g., a cryptocurrency).

NFTs became popularized with digital art projects like CryptoKitties (2017), CryptoPunks (2017), Bored Ape Yacht Club (2021), and the record-setting Beeple’s artwork Everydays (2021) that sold for 69 million dollars.

What is Staking

In crypto, the meaning of staking describes the action of locking tokens with the expectation of earning returns.

There are two fundamentally different forms of staking tokens: 

  1. In one form, the tokens are put to work and are at risk (e.g., as collateral for a particular activity, such as Proof-of-Stake (PoS), lending, etc.). 
  2. In other forms, tokens are simply removed from circulation (e.g., to enable the token’s price to appreciate due to reduced supply).
